Abstract

The Li6(α,α) reaction was studied at Eα=50 MeV. The angular distribution of the continuum region near the α6+d breakup threshold (1.475 MeV) was measured for θlab=7°–40°. The data were analyzed in terms of plane-wave and distorted-wave impulse approximation calculations. To study the possible effects of recombination of the breakup clusters in the exit channel, distorted-wave Born approximation calculations were also performed.
